Using the ▲/▼ buttons adjusts the strength of whole color.

COLOR

Strong ó Weak

• This item can be selected only for a video signal, s-video or com-

 

 

ponent video signal.

 

Using the ▲/▼ buttons adjusts the tint.

TINT

Greenish ó Reddish

• This item can be selected only for a video signal, s-video or com-

 

 

ponent video signal.

 

Using the ▲/▼ buttons adjusts the sharpness.

SHARPNESS

Strong ó Weak

• There may be some noise and/or the screen may flicker for a mo-

 

 

ment when an adjustment is made. This is not a malfunction.
